DATE CHANGE! 26th Annual Downtown Hoedown to be held one week early… May 9-11th at Hart Plaza in Detroit Due to the ACM Awards Broadcast, scheduled for May 18th on CBS-TV First time the Hoedown will be held on the second weekend of may instead of the third
3
What is the Hoedown? A three-day music festival Known as the “World’s Largest Free Country Music Concert” Includes food, fun, dancing, mechanical bull rides, shopping and more For the entire family
4
History of the Hoedown Began in 1983 Started as a one-day event First stars included Hank Williams Jr., Tanya Tucker, The Kendals, Brenda Lee and Mel Tillis Evolved into a three-day festival

Who plays the Hoedown? Local bands come on first at around noon Nashville Newcomers follow in the afternoon Established artists headline in the evening
9
When and Where? Hart Plaza, along Detroit’s beautiful riverfront bordering Windsor, Ontario The second weekend in May May 9 10 11, 2008 From noon to midnight
